DESCRIPTION
Receive Loss of Frame Declaration/Clearance Criteria
Select:
This READ/WRITE bit-field permits the user to select the Loss of
Frame (LOF) Declaration and Clearance Criteria.
0 - LOF will be declared if the Frame Synchronizer block resides
within the OOF (Out-of-Frame) state for 24 E3 frame periods.
LOF will also be cleared once the Frame Synchronizer resides
within the "In-Frame" state for 24 E3 frame period.
1 - LOF will be declared if the Frame Synchronizer block resides
within the OOF state for 8 E3 frame periods. LOF will also be
cleared once the Frame Synchronizer block resides within the
"In-Frame" state for 8 E3 frame periods.
Receive Loss of Frame Defect Indicator:
This READ-ONLY bit-field indicates whether or not the Frame
Synchronizer block is currently declaring the LOF condition.
0 - Frame Synchronizer is NOT declaring an LOF condition with
the incoming data stream.
1 - Frame Synchronizer is currently declaring an LOF condition
with the incoming data stream.
NOTE: This bit-field is not valid if the Frame Synchronizer block
is by-passed.
Receive Out of Frame Defect Indicator:
This READ-ONLY bit-field indicates whether or not the Frame
Synchronizer block is currently declaring the OOF condition.
0 - Frame Synchronizer is NOT declaring an OOF condition with
the incoming data stream.
1 - Frame Synchronizer is currently declaring an OOF condition
with the incoming data stream.
NOTE: This bit-field is not valid if the Frame Synchronizer block
is by-passed.
Receive Loss of Signal Defect Indicator:
This READ-ONLY bit-field indicates whether or not the Frame
Synchronizer block is currently declaring the LOS condition.
0 - Frame Synchronizer/Channel is NOT declaring an LOS con-
dition in the incoming data stream.
1 - Frame Synchronizer/Channel is currently declaring an LOS
condition in the incoming data stream.
